Parking Lot Leveling in Atlanta, GA
Parking lot leveling services involve adjusting the surface of a parking area to create a smooth, even surface. This process is commonly used for commercial and residential properties with asphalt, concrete, or gravel lots that have developed uneven spots, dips, or drainage issues over time. Projects typically include restoring the proper slope for water runoff, fixing sunken or cracked areas, and preparing the lot for resurfacing or sealing. Parking Lot Leveling Questions
What is parking lot leveling? Parking lot leveling involves adjusting the surface to eliminate uneven areas and improve stability for vehicles and pedestrians.
When should property owners consider parking lot leveling? It is recommended when cracks, dips, or uneven surfaces develop that could cause drainage issues or safety concerns.
What types of surfaces can be leveled? Asphalt and concrete parking lots are common surfaces that can be effectively leveled to restore a flat, even surface.
How does parking lot leveling benefit property owners? Proper leveling enhances safety, improves drainage, and extends the lifespan of the parking surface.
